There are ways to change your visitor visa inside Canada and work here legally. Visitors in Canada can choose the study pathway to change their status to study permit without going back to their home country. We can help you to enroll as a full-time student at DLI Schools. You can join Co-op programs in top private colleges like Toronto school of management (TSOM) or Georgian at ILAC, Toronto where you get to study and work up to 20hrs per week. 2. Applying for a work permit as a visitor to work legally in Canada
mmig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C) has introduced a public policy that allows visitors to apply for work permits inside Canada. The policy was initially introduced on August 24, 2020. Further, IRCC extended the previous deadline of February 28, 2022, to change visitor visa to work permit inside Canada to February 28, 2023.
Currently, the eligibility conditions were broadened to allow any visitors in Canada with valid temporary residence status, regardless of when they arrived, to apply within the country for an employer-specific work visa.
